In vivo photoacoustic flowmetry in the optical diffusive regime based on saline injection [PDF]
We propose a saline-injection-based method to quantify blood flow velocity in vivo with acoustic-resolution photoacoustic tomography. By monitoring the saline-blood-interface propagating in the blood vessel, we can resolve the flow velocity.

Functional Ultrasound Speckle Decorrelation‐Based Velocimetry of the Brain
A high‐speed, contrast‐free, quantitative ultrasound velocimetry (vUS) for blood flow velocity imaging throughout the rodent brain is developed based on the normalized first‐order temporal autocorrelation function of the ultrasound field signal.

The Importance of Velocity Acceleration to Flow-Mediated Dilation
The validity of the flow-mediated dilation test has been questioned due to the lack of normalization to the primary stimulus, shear stress. Shear stress can be calculated using Poiseuille's law.
